Gristmill runs in three environments: dev, staging, and prod, all deployed from the same pipeline. Each environment carries a static-analysis baseline file checked into the repo root; it suppresses pre-existing findings so the scanner only fails builds on new issues. Reviewers should note the baseline is regenerated only via a signed pipeline job — manual edits are rejected at merge time. Staging mirrors prod except for scan frequency. For reference during your review, the staging instance uses the configuration values below.

deployment values, yafop-tahof:
HOLIX_HOST=holix.zemvarsys.internal
HOLIX_PORT=3306

Handover — cold starts, for the eng sync

Hey Priya, quick brain-dump before I'm out. The Lumenfall handlers are still cold-starting around 4s on first hit; I bumped provisioned concurrency on the checkout path and it helped. Warmer pings are in the cron repo. If you need to unlock the tuning vault while I'm gone, the recovery passphrase is below.

vault phrase of fahog-yajog = frawyn-jordor-casael-gormir-olieth-julmir

**Release checklist — SproutCycle v2.4**

Quick one for the sync: before we ship the new watering scheduler, confirm the drought-mode override actually pauses all zones, not just the first. Last time it quietly kept soaking the herb beds. Also double-check the sunrise-offset math for southern-hemisphere users — Marisol fixed it but nobody re-tested. Once QA signs off, tag the candidate and paste the token right under this item.

build token for fahap-yagag: htk3_d09